Baripada Police Crack Youth’s Murder Case; Arrest Victim’s Friends

Mayurbhanj by Mayurbhanj
December 27, 2024
in Odisha

Baripada: Police have cracked the murder case of a youth whose body was recovered from the bank of Budhabalang river at Gumudihi under Baripada Sadar police limits on Thursday.

Police have identified the deceased as Chandan Swain (33) of Hindulia village under Marshaghai police limits in Kendrapara district, and arrested two people in connection with the crime.

One accused, Ashish Singh, was arrested from Balasore railway station and his friend from Jambani village.

According to reports, Chandan’s body was spotted by a villager who informed the police about this. Following this, Baripada Sadar SDPO Sujit Kumar Pradhan, Baripada Sadar police station officer Madhusmita Mohanty and Baripada Town police station officer Sumit Kumar Soren reached the spot and conducted an investigation. The youth’s body was buried in the sand, and a scientific team exhumed it out in the presence of a magistrate. The police, after examining the circumstances, suspected that it was a murder.

The youth was killed almost a week ago and his body was buried in sand on the river bank. A case was registered at the Baripada Sadar police station in this connection and the police started an investigation.

During investigation it was found that the deceased’s friends had kidnapped him and called his family members for ransom money.

Subsequently, his family members living in Bhubaneswar lodged a complaint at the Kharbela Nagar police station.

The accused have confessed to their crime, said Baripada Sadar SDPO Sujit Kumar Pradhan.
